Hello all. I just started collecting and I think this is going to be my first real find. Love to hear what you all think as far as grade, value, etc. I think this is a "large date" cent. Maybe someone could confirm?

I placed the 1960 next to a 2010 to try to display color but I'm not sure this image is of a good enough quality. The 1960 is the "orange" color that I have read about. Very pretty coin.

Yes, that is a large date. The small date variety is more scarce, and therefore more valuable.

I can't see it well enough to grade it, but I'd guess it is high AU at the very least.
